PROBATION REVOKED FOR CATTLE THEFT SUSPECT

  

Three people have been sentenced in the latest edition of 21st Judicial District Court in Brenham.

54-year old Benjamin Gonzalez of Houston had his probation revoked and was sentenced to four years in prison and fined $1000 for a 2012 Theft of Cattle conviction.

Gonzalez was originally arrested by Washington County Sheriff’s deputies and a ranger with the Texas and Southwestern Cattle Raisers Association after he allegedly stole calves from his employer’s ranch in Washington County and selling them at an auction in Giddings.

Also in District Court:

45-year old Gustavo Rivera Sanchez of Houston, was sentenced to four years in prison for an August DWI.

Sanchez was charged with Driving While Intoxicated 3rd or More Offense – a Third Degree Felony.

And, 25-year old Haley Noel Buckingham of Brenham, was placed on three years’ probation for Possession of Controlled Substance – a State Jail Felony.

Buckingham was also fine $500 and ordered to perform 100 hours of community service.
